++ Re: International Transfers / Secondments carole Harden 23/04/2005 19:09
Think carefully about what happens after the secondment. What does the individual come back to and with what expectations. If they are going overseas what happens about their base country pension. Do you maintain it on a hypothetical salary or match the secondment figure. Consider medical benefits and ensure the individual is not disadvantaged if they go to a location which does not provide as generous cover.
